A moderate earthquake measuring 4.3 on the Richter scale struck the city of Preveza in Epirus on the northwest coast of Greece at 9:49 am Wednesday.
According to the Athens Geodynamic Institute, the epicenter of the earthquake was in the sea area 9 km northwest of Preveza.
The focal depth of the earthquake is 9 km.
There are no reports of personal injury or property damage. …
